package main
import (
"fmt"
"github.com/Centny/gwf/netw/hrv"
"github.com/Centny/gwf/pool"
"github.com/Centny/gwf/util"
"os"
"runtime"
"strconv"
"time"
)
var ef func(c int) = os.Exit
func usage() {
fmt.Println(`Usage: hrv options
-f server configure file, running server mode.
-s HRV server host, running client mode.
-base reverse client base http url
-token reverse client login token
-name reverse client login name
-alias reverse client login alias
-hb 30 the HB time,default 30s
-l if show the log
-h show this.
`)
}
func main() {
var f, s string
var base, token, name, alias string
var log bool = false
var hb int = 30
olen := len(os.Args)
for i := 1; i < olen; i++ {
switch os.Args[i] {
case "-f":
if i < olen-1 {
f = os.Args[i+1]
}
case "-s":
if i < olen-1 {
s = os.Args[i+1]
i++
}
case "-base":
if i < olen-1 {
base = os.Args[i+1]
i++
}
case "-token":
if i < olen-1 {
token = os.Args[i+1]
i++
}
case "-name":
if i < olen-1 {
name = os.Args[i+1]
i++
}
case "-alias":
if i < olen-1 {
alias = os.Args[i+1]
i++
}
case "-hb":
if i < olen-1 {
t, err := strconv.ParseInt(os.Args[i+1], 10, 32)
if err != nil {
fmt.Println(err.Error())
ef(1)
return
}
hb = int(t)
i++
}
case "-l":
log = true
case "-h":
usage()
ef(1)
return
}
}
runtime.GOMAXPROCS(util.CPU())
if len(s) > 0 {
RunHrvC(s, base, token, name, alias, log, hb)
} else if len(f) > 0 {
RunHrvS(f)
} else {
usage()
}
}
var hs *hrv.CfgSrvH
var hc *hrv.HrvC
//run HRV server.
func RunHrvS(f string) {
var err error
bp := pool.NewBytePool(8, 1024000)
hs, err = hrv.NewCfgSrvH(bp, f)
if err != nil {
panic(err.Error())
}
hs.Run()
}
//run HRV client
func RunHrvC(addr, base, token, name, alias string, log bool, hb int) {
bp := pool.NewBytePool(8, 1024000)
hc = hrv.NewHrvC_j(bp, addr, base)
hc.ShowLog = log
hc.Token = token
hc.Name = name
hc.Alias = alias
hc.Start()
go func() {
for {
hc.HB()
time.Sleep(time.Duration(hb) * time.Second)
}
}()
hc.Wait()
}
